Your Sunset & Stargazing Safari begins with a comfortable, climate-controlled coach pickup from one of our convenient hotel collection points in South Tenerife. Settle in and enjoy the journey as our guides bring Teide National Park to life, sharing fascinating facts, volcanic history, unique flora and fauna, and ancient stories linked to this remarkable landscape. A UNESCO World Heritage Site, Teide is one of the Canary Islands’ most iconic natural treasures, and your adventure starts the moment you step aboard.
As the golden hour approaches, we stop at Montaña Sámara. High in Teide National Park, Montaña Sámara offers sweeping sunset views across volcanic lava fields, pine-clad valleys and the distant silhouette of Mount Teide. From 2,000 m above sea level, the sky ignites with colour as the sun sinks toward the Atlantic, often revealing neighbouring islands on clear evenings. Enjoy a complimentary glass of chilled cava or orange juice as you soak up the romance of a stunning sunset above the Sea of Clouds.
